Einstein-Relative Thinking wood print by Bill Manson.   Bring your artwork to life with the texture and added depth of a wood print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 3/4" thick maple wood. There are D-clips on the back of the print for mounting it to your wall using mounting hooks and nails (included).

BILL MANSON Fine Art Artist Bio Bill Manson is a professional artist whose art is pulsating with color and incorporates energetic graphic styled designs with dazzling style and grace. Bill was born in Longview, Washington and grew up in the Northwestern United States in his childhood years. Having lived in Washington state, Oregon and Idaho grew his passion and love for color. He now resides in Phoenix, Arizona and has a studio where he creates his wonderful works. Bill graduated from Grand Canyon College in Phoenix, Arizona with a Bachelors of Secondary Education with a concentration in Music.
